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Filton Abbey Wood to Burntisland start from as little as £69.00

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Filton Abbey Wood to Burntisland start from £139.80 one way, or £224.70 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Filton Abbey Wood to Burntisland are available for £246.70 one way, or £493.30 return

Station Facilities

When you arrive at Filton Abbey Wood, you'll find the facilities modest but convenient. The ticket office operates Monday to Friday from 16:15 to 19:15. You'll also find ticket machines, enabling you to collect tickets purchased online. The station features an induction loop for those who are hearing impaired.

Filton Abbey Wood provides step-free platform access through a ramp bridge. However, the gradient might be steeper than current guidelines suggest. Although there are no waiting rooms or separate lounges, there is a seating area available. Make note: there aren't any toilets or baby-changing facilities present.

Parking is a breeze with available spaces that are open 24/7, and it's free. Unfortunately, if you've got a craving or need cash, you might need to wait until you reach your destination as there are no refreshment facilities or ATMs available on-site.

Facilities and Accessibility

While Burntisland station may not boast an extensive range of shops or dining options—no refreshment facilities or ATMs can be found here—it does offer a variety of essential services to ensure a seamless experience for passengers. Staff help and customer information are available during certain weekday and Saturday hours, with help points placed conveniently around the station for your ease.

The station features step-free access on certain platforms, although travelers should note that the ramps and footbridge make it a Category B3 station. An induction loop is available, but you'd need to bear in mind the absence of amenities like accessible toilets, accessible taxis, and a proper pickup/drop-off point for passengers with reduced mobility.
